src/views/exam-list/index.vue |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
src/views/grade-list/index.vue |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 | |
src/views/train/index.vue | 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史 |
src/views/exam-list/index.vue
@@ -8,17 +8,19 @@ <el-card class="h-full" :body-style="{ height: '100%' }"> <div class="card-wrapper w-full h-full flex flex-col px-8 box-border"> <div class="card-header flex justify-between items-center shrink-0"> <div class="header-tab"> <!-- <div class="header-tab"> <el-tabs v-model="activeName" @tab-click="handleClick"> <el-tab-pane label="全部" name="1"></el-tab-pane> <el-tab-pane label="未开始" name="2"></el-tab-pane> <el-tab-pane label="进行中" name="3"></el-tab-pane> <el-tab-pane label="已结束" name="4"></el-tab-pane> </el-tabs> </div> </div> --> <div class="header-search flex items-center"> <el-input v-model="searchText" placeholder="请输入考试名称" :prefix-icon="Search" /> <el-button type="primary" class="ml-4">搜索</el-button> <el-input v-model="searchText" placeholder="请输入考试名称" :prefix-icon="Search" maxlength="20" /> <el-button type="primary" class="ml-4" @click="searchData">搜索</el-button> </div> </div> @@ -60,7 +62,7 @@ const getData = () => { loading.value = true; getExamList().then(res => { getExamList({ examName: searchText.value }).then(res => { dataList.value = res.data; loading.value = false; }).catch(err => { @@ -70,6 +72,10 @@ getData(); const searchData = () => { getData(); }; const handleClick = (tab, event) => { }; </script> src/views/grade-list/index.vue
@@ -7,15 +7,17 @@ <el-card class="h-full" :body-style="{ height: '100%' }"> <div class="card-wrapper w-full h-full flex flex-col px-8 box-border"> <div class="card-header flex justify-between items-center shrink-0"> <div class="header-tab"> <!-- <div class="header-tab"> <el-tabs v-model="activeName" @tab-click="handleClick"> <el-tab-pane label="全部" name="1"></el-tab-pane> <el-tab-pane label="已批改" name="2"></el-tab-pane> <el-tab-pane label="未批改" name="3"></el-tab-pane> </el-tabs> </div> </div> --> <div class="header-search flex items-center"> <el-input v-model="searchText" placeholder="请输入考试名称" :prefix-icon="Search" /> <el-input v-model="searchText" placeholder="请输入考试名称" :prefix-icon="Search" maxlength="20"/> <el-button type="primary" class="ml-4" @click="searchData">搜索</el-button> </div> src/views/train/index.vue
@@ -8,17 +8,19 @@ <el-card class="h-full" :body-style="{ height: '100%' }"> <div class="card-wrapper w-full h-full flex flex-col px-8 box-border"> <div class="card-header flex justify-between items-center shrink-0"> <div class="header-tab"> <!-- <div class="header-tab"> <el-tabs v-model="activeName" @tab-click="handleClick"> <el-tab-pane label="全部" name="1"></el-tab-pane> <el-tab-pane label="未开始" name="2"></el-tab-pane> <el-tab-pane label="进行中" name="3"></el-tab-pane> <el-tab-pane label="已结束" name="4"></el-tab-pane> </el-tabs> </div> </div> --> <div class="header-search flex items-center"> <el-input v-model="searchText" placeholder="请输入课程名称" :prefix-icon="Search" /> <el-button type="primary" class="ml-4">搜索</el-button> <el-input v-model="searchText" placeholder="请输入课程名称" :prefix-icon="Search" maxlength="20" /> <el-button type="primary" class="ml-4" @click="searchData">搜索</el-button> </div> </div> @@ -53,7 +55,7 @@ const getData = () => { loading.value = true; getMeetList().then(res => { getMeetList({meetName: searchText.value}).then(res => { dataList.value = res.data; loading.value = false; }).catch(err => { @@ -63,6 +65,11 @@ getData(); const searchData = () => { getData(); }; const handleClick = (tab, event) => { };